aboutsummaryrefslogtreecommitdiffstats
path: root/s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p
diff options
context:
space:
mode:
authorFriedemann Kleint <Friedemann.Kleint@qt.io>2022-04-22 11:04:37 +0200
committerFriedemann Kleint <Friedemann.Kleint@qt.io>2022-04-25 18:45:26 +0200
commita3e882b06eda8f9a63cf3834a99640034775269b (patch)
tree3598dfbfdfcbd5e345eaa2c6ea86a8445d0feb5d /s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p
parent3d8431182e97c9c87220e8d8ddfcd3abde22e31d (diff)
shiboken6: Remove deprecated QLatin1String
Introduce a compatibility header to provide the 6.4 API to 6.3 to reduce merge conflicts. Task-number: QTBUG-98434 Pick-to: 6.3 6.2 Change-Id: Iab3f9f894019b4135afa96b930325966348210d0 Reviewed-by: Christian Tismer <tismer@stackless.com>
Diffstat (limited to 's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p')
-rw-r--r--s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p10
1 files changed, 7 insertions, 3 deletions
diff --git a/s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p b/s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p
index f98077d3d..fcfc506af 100644
--- a/s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p
+++ b/sources/shiboken6/ApiExtractor/tests/testmodifydocumentation.cpp
@@ -34,10 +34,14 @@
#include <typesystem.h>
#include <qtdocparser.h>
+#include <qtcompat.h>
+
#include <QtCore/QCoreApplication>
#include <QtCore/QTemporaryDir>
#include <QtTest/QTest>
+using namespace Qt::StringLiterals;
+
void TestModifyDocumentation::testModifyDocumentation()
{
const char* cppCode ="struct B { void b(); }; class A {};\n";
@@ -65,10 +69,10 @@ R"(<typesystem package="Foo">
// Create a temporary directory for the documentation file since libxml2
// cannot handle Qt resources.
- QTemporaryDir tempDir(QDir::tempPath() + QLatin1String("/shiboken_testmodifydocXXXXXX"));
+ QTemporaryDir tempDir(QDir::tempPath() + u"/shiboken_testmodifydocXXXXXX"_s);
QVERIFY2(tempDir.isValid(), qPrintable(tempDir.errorString()));
- const QString docFileName = QLatin1String("a.xml");
- QVERIFY(QFile::copy(QLatin1String(":/") + docFileName, tempDir.filePath(docFileName)));
+ const QString docFileName = u"a.xml"_s;
+ QVERIFY(QFile::copy(u":/"_s + docFileName, tempDir.filePath(docFileName)));
QtDocParser docParser;
docParser.setDocumentationDataDirectory(tempDir.path());